Rerunning the NSA cup I missed the last weekend in Bistrica. Map was looking far too tasty to miss it before heading home so took the boys out for a treat.
Map was actually quite weird since the mapper because of the number of pits he mapped which was in the order of thousands decided to make the map 1:7,500 but leave the symbols on the 1:10,000 scale. That was very confusing to my distance estimation sense as well as obviously the legibility of the map with that amount of detail.
The actual training was quite horrendous in terms of tekkers, couldn't really make sense of the contours in the tricky bits and also struggled a lot to find the mini square tapes on the controls since I could never be sure I am on the right pit indeed so leaving by saying 'it must be here' felt wrong.
Will upload the map later but seems like a prime training spot for WUOC middle just need to fix the mapping issues by getting rid of all pits and rescaling the symbols.

Beroe 5k - 15:40 (timing is saying 15:32 but once again my chip must have been hacked)
Quite excited for the first ever certified road race in Bulgaria, atmosphere wasn't quite the Podium Festival but made me happy as a patriot.
The race itself was big 'meh'. Went off fairly quick the first k at 2:51 but that was due to the 20m of negative elevation. Then was immediately in no man's land for the rest of the run. Hard last two k with 15m of climb in each to finish me off. Nothing really to be happy with even if I can't tell how much slower that course is with that climb and the two 180 degrees where we literally stopped and turned around but in the books now.
